Isa Gusau: President Tinubu Condoles With Gov Zulum
President Bola Tinubu has reacted to the news of the passing of Isa Gusau, Special Adviser on Public Relations and Strategy to Babagana Zulum, Governor of Borno State.

President Tinubu condoled with the Gusau family, the professional colleagues of the late Gusau, and the government and people of Borno State over this agonizing loss, in a statement on late Friday.
According to the statement, “the late Gusau was a diligent professional who was uncompromising on his virtuous principles.”
The statement read further: “He was a member of the Chartered Institute of Public Relations, UK; the Nigerian Institute of Public Relations; the Public Relations and Communications Association (PRCA) UK; the International Public Relations Association, UK, and the African Public Relations Association.
The late Gusau was also an exceptional gentleman, patriotic, and dedicated to the service of the people.
The President prays for the repose of the soul of the departed and comfort for all those who mourn this painful loss.
